    DAOs are suppose to be different

    • DAOs are suppose let everyone vote, and most are stake weighted, but many are one account, one vote.
    • The oroginal Steemleo White paper spoke of this community eventually becoming DAO run, and we are evolving towards this goal.
    • The recent Sunsetting of Cubfinance and Polycub are good examples of this evolution of our commuity towards governance, and I think it deserves a pause to reflect on where we have been and where we are going.

The Holy Grail or ultimate goal of decentralized distributed economies is a DAO, a Decentralized Autonomous Organization.
    • These are present in cryptocurrency society, in varying stages of development, and even various purposes. Some are for governance, some are for fund raising for profit and others fund raising for charity.
    • We have slowly evolved as a community to where we have staked based voting as we did on PolyCub and now staked based polling on Inleo to decide the fate of CUbfinance and Polycub.
